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ians arrive on-site and assess the damage to find out the extent of the leak and the affected area. We use th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den water sources and we work quickly to contain the damage and prevent further complications.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
We use specialized equipment to extract the water and dry out the affected area, reducing the risk of mold growth and structural damage. We use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and we monitor the area to ensure everything is drying properly.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, we use eco-friendly cleaning products to sanitize the space and remove any remaining moisture. We use ant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old growth and we work to restore your home to its original condition.
Step 4: Restoration and Repairs
Finally, we make any necessary repairs to restore your home to its original condition. We work with local contractors to ensure seamless repairs and we keep you updated on the progress every step of the way.

Q: What causes HVAC leaks?
A: HVAC le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ged air filters, frozen coils, and improper installation.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ent it from happening again.
